Lines Matching refs:quser
79 struct quota_user *quser = QUOTA_USER_CONTEXT_REQUIRE(_mail->box->storage->user);
94 if (quser->quota->set->vsizes)
218 struct quota_user *quser = QUOTA_USER_CONTEXT_REQUIRE(src_ns->user);
221 array_foreach(&quser->quota->roots, rootp) {
410 struct quota_user *quser = QUOTA_USER_CONTEXT_REQUIRE(box->storage->user);
473 if (ibox->vsize_update != NULL && quser->quota->set->vsizes)
495 else if (!quser->quota->set->vsizes) {
540 struct quota_user *quser = QUOTA_USER_CONTEXT_REQUIRE(box->storage->user);
551 quota_roots_flush(quser->quota);
610 struct quota_user *quser = QUOTA_USER_CONTEXT(user);
612 return quser == NULL ? NULL : quser->quota;
617 struct quota_user *quser = QUOTA_USER_CONTEXT_REQUIRE(user);
618 struct quota_settings *quota_set = quser->quota->set;
620 quota_deinit(&quser->quota);
621 quser->module_ctx.super.deinit(user);
629 struct quota_user *quser;
648 quser = p_new(user->pool, struct quota_user, 1);
649 quser->module_ctx.super = *v;
650 user->vlast = &quser->module_ctx.super;
652 quser->quota = quota;
654 MODULE_CONTEXT_SET(user, quota_user_module, quser);